为什么星星是靛色的

星星在夜空中常常呈现出靛色或蓝色的外观,这让许多人好奇为什么它们不是其他颜色。实际上,星星的颜色与其表面温度密切相关,而靛色通常与较冷的恒星有关。本文将探讨星星颜色的成因,包括光谱分布、人眼对光的感知以及大气散射等因素,解释为何我们看到的星星多为靛色。

为什么星星是靛色的

在夜空中,当我们仰望星空时,许多星星看起来呈现出靛色或蓝色,这让人不禁思考:为什么星星是靛色的?星星的颜色并非凭空而来,而是由其表面温度、光谱特性以及地球大气的影响共同决定的。 首先,星星的颜色与其温度直接相关。科学家通过光谱分析发现,恒星发出的光在不同波长上有不同的强度分布。温度较高的恒星,如蓝白色恒星,会发出更多的短波长光,例如蓝光和紫光。而温度较低的恒星,如红矮星,发出的光则偏向长波长,如红光和橙光。靛色通常出现在温度中等的恒星上,这类恒星的光谱中蓝光和绿光的强度较高,但不足以让它们看起来是纯蓝色的,因此在人眼中呈现出靛色。 其次,人眼对不同颜色的光有不同的敏感度。视网膜中的视锥细胞对红、绿、蓝三种颜色的光最为敏感,而靛色位于蓝和紫之间,属于人眼能够识别但并不特别敏感的波段。因此,当星光穿过地球大气层时,靛色的光更容易被散射,使得我们在夜空中看到的星星颜色偏蓝或靛色,尤其是在没有光污染的地区。 此外,大气散射也对星星的颜色产生影响。地球的大气层会将光线向各个方向散射,尤其是波长较短的光更容易被散射。这种现象被称为瑞利散射。在白天,我们看到的天空呈现蓝色,正是因为大气散射了太阳光中的蓝光。而在夜晚,由于星光的强度较低,加上大气中微粒和气体的散射作用,靛色的光更容易被保留下来,使得星星在夜空中显得更加蓝或靛。 不过,并非所有星星都呈现靛色。例如,太阳在地球上看是黄色的,但在太空中则是白色,因为它发出的光包含了所有可见光波长。同样,一些遥远的恒星由于红移效应,其光谱被拉长,颜色也会偏红。因此,星星的颜色会随着其温度、距离和大气条件的不同而有所变化。 还有一个常见的误解是,星星在夜空中看起来是靛色的,是因为它们本身是靛色的。实际上,大多数恒星的光在可见光范围内是连续光谱,而我们看到的颜色只是光谱中某一波段的综合表现。例如,一颗温度适中的恒星可能在光谱中发出较多的靛蓝色光,因此在我们眼中呈现出靛色。 除了恒星本身的颜色外,观测条件也会影响我们对星星颜色的感知。在城市中,光污染会使得夜空中的星星显得更暗、更模糊,甚至可能被掩盖成白色或灰色。而在高海拔或远离城市的地方,由于空气更稀薄,星光受到的散射更少,颜色会更加明显和真实。 总的来说,星星呈现靛色的原因是多方面的。它们的表面温度决定了光谱的分布,人眼对光的感知方式以及地球大气的散射作用共同影响了我们看到的颜色。了解这些因素,不仅有助于我们更好地欣赏星空,也能加深对宇宙中恒星特性的理解。下次当你仰望夜空时,不妨想想,那些闪烁的靛色星星背后隐藏着怎样的科学原理。